SIG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2019 in Review

198 of the 4,560 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Signet Jewelers (SIG) for Q3 2019, worth a combined $1.03B — up 4.2% from $987M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 40 funds opened new SIG positions and 39 closed out — a net gain of 1 holder — while 77 added to existing stakes and 55 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Select Equity Group, opening a new position worth an estimated $33.6M. The largest seller was Susquehanna International Group, cutting an estimated $13.9M.
